i schooled in tonongoi primary school where i completed my junior school there. thereafter i went to chemamul high school where i completed my A levels. life is hard but due to my extra work and perseeverance i have totally conquered. my children are hardworking and 3 want to be doctors while 4 are still young. during my free time i like reading bible.
the goods i sell are normally foodstuffs and also electronics which is of high demand. i chose thus business because in my area i used to see hoq goods are sold and very fast moving so i decided to open it up. the costs are minimal at 3% of the total income. when i get profits i pay school fees for my children and also reinvest the remaining back into the business
if granted the loan i use to buy grocery like rice and sugar costing 70$ and the rest i will use to increase my electronics in the shop. this will increase my sales by 30% which will help me get more cystomers hence high demand. i will get more profit which in turn will help me pay my children school fees without any difficulty.
